  • Valves And Protective Devices

    WIKA Alexander Wiegand SE & Co. KG

    Via cocks, shut-off valves, valve manifolds or monoflanges, pressure measuring instruments can be securely separated from the process during commissioning, maintenance or calibration. Protective devices, such as syphons, overpressure protectors and snubbers, increase the service life and extend the application spectrum of pressure measuring instruments. Alongside the extensive selection of instrumentation valves and accessories, WIKA also offers qualified assembly of different individual components into a complete measuring arrangement (“hook-up”).

  • Precision Pressure Measuring Instruments

    WIKA Alexander Wiegand SE & Co. KG

    Precision pressure measuring instruments are electrical measuring systems which convert pressure into an electrical signal and optionally visualise it. Precise pressure transmitters and process transmitters are used for the monitoring and control of particularly sensitive processes. Due to the low, DKD/DAkkS certified measurement uncertainty of down to 0.008 % of the entire measuring chain, the particularly accurate instruments find their primary applications as a factory/working standard for testing and/or calibrating a variety of pressure measuring instruments.

  • Load Cells

    WIKA Alexander Wiegand SE & Co. KG

    Load cells are designed as a special form of force transducer for use in weighing equipment. These force transducers enable very high measurement accuracies of 0.01 % and 0.05 % of FS. Load cells are used in the widest variety of application areas, including platform, filling, belt and packaging scales, dynamic test systems as well as electronic precision, price-labelling and industrial scales. WIKA provides you with all typical and widely used load cell geometries such as single point load cells, bending and shear beam load cells, s-type load cells, canister load cells and compression force load cells. In addition, there are corresponding mounting kits and complete weighing modules available.

  • Pressure Gauges

    WIKA Alexander Wiegand SE & Co. KG

    Our pressure gauges (mechanical pressure measuring instruments) for gauge, absolute and differential pressure have been proven millions of times over. For the optimal solution for the widest range of applications, there is a choice of measuring systems in Bourdon tube, diaphragm element and capsule element technologies. The pressure gauges cover scale ranges from 0 … 0.5 mbar to 0 … 6,000 bar and indication accuracies of up to 0.1 %. For the various requirements in industrial and process instrumentation there are pressure elements from copper alloys, stainless steel or special materials available.

  • Pressure Balances

    WIKA Alexander Wiegand SE & Co. KG

    Pressure balances (often also referred to as mechanical dead-weight testers or primary standards) are the most accurate reference instruments for pressure. Their functional principle is based on the physical principle of pressure = force/area. Mass pieces placed on the top of a piston-cylinder system are the source of a precisely defined force. By producing a certain (counter) pressure inside the pressure balance an equilibrium is achieved: the mass pieces, including the free-running piston of the piston-cylinder system, are floating, which will lead to a very accurate pressure at the test port.

  • Tension/compression Force Transducers

    WIKA Alexander Wiegand SE & Co. KG

    WIKA offers tension/compression force transducers in different designs and versions. They are available in miniature designs, as traditional s-type versions, as transducers with different thread forms or as low-profile force transducers (pancake). Transducers in miniature design are used for small mounting spaces and also for detecting small forces. The s-type with female thread, which is very well suited for this purpose, features a particularly high accuracy and is used in rated load ranges of up to 50 kN. For measuring high forces, tension/compression force transducers in compact size are the first choice. For low-profile force transducers, the force is transmitted via the centrical female thread. They are highly dynamic and possess a high fatigue strength.
